Uganda: Primates & Birds

11 - 20 Jun 2026

Uganda

FULLY BOOKED​

A journey closer to the heart of Africa to reveal some of the continent's most valuable secrets - starting with a cruise on a lake in search of the mighty Shoebill followed a few days later by a trek into Bwindi in search of some of the last remaining Mountain Gorillas. Tree-climbing lions, the subject of several nature documentaries for their extraordinary behaviour are likely to be encountered, as well as the Chimpanzees of Kibale.

Pumas of Patagonia

9 - 15 Nov 2026

Chile

​4 SPACES LEFT

One of the planet's final frontiers, Patagonia is a truly wild place. On this tour we shall spend several days in this incredible landscape, including two full days in Torres del Paine National Park. While there will be many South American birds on show, the target is undoubtedly the mighty Puma. We will be accompanied by skilled Puma trackers on this trip, sightings and close encounters are effectively guaranteed.
